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Penychain to Meadowhall start from as little as £26.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Penychain to Meadowhall are available for £99.30 one way

Facilities and Amenities

Though modest, Penychain Station provides essential services suitable for travelers seeking a back-to-basics rail experience. Notably, there are no ticket offices or machines available at Penychain, so it's essential to purchase and collect your tickets in advance, possibly online. However, the station is equipped with an induction loop to cater to passengers with hearing impairments. You'll be glad to find step-free access throughout, categorized as Type A, which ensures easy movement via a ramp with handrails from the country road.

For those needing assistance, there's no on-site staff availability, but you can book help via Passenger Assist in advance of your journey. Although there are no lounging areas at the station, a seating area is available for waiting passengers. Abundant free car parking offers a convenient option for those traveling by road to Penychain. And while there are no refreshments or ATM services on-site, the nearby town ensures you won't go without your essentials for too long.

Transport Connections

In terms of onward travel, Penychain ensures smooth connectivity despite its rural setting. For rail replacement services, the closest bus stop is near the entrance to the Hafan y Mor holiday park, offering periodic services. Alternatively, walk roughly 300 meters to the main road to access local bus routes. Facilities and Amenities at Meadowhall Station

At Meadowhall station, ticket purchasing is hassle-free with the ticket office open from 06:00 to 20:15 on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ays from 09:00 to 19:30. For those who prefer self-service options, ticket machines are available and accessible, accepting both cash and cards. The station also supports smartcard purchases, although validators are not available.

When it comes to amenities, the station ensures that passengers with mobility challenges are well-catered for, offering step-free access throughout. This accessibility extends to the availability of accessible toilets and seating areas. However, for those needing extra assistance, staff help is on hand to ensure every passenger's needs are met.

While there are no luggage storage facilities or CCTV, rest assured that essential services like toilets and customer help points are present. If you're feeling peckish or in need of a quick shopping spree, refreshment facilities and shops are conveniently located within the station.

Onward Travel Options

One of Meadowhall's strengths is its seamless connections to various forms of transport. The station is a critical node with bus services readily accessible at the adjacent bus station. You can hop onto the Supertram, providing ease of travel across Sheffield, including to Sheffield Stadium. Taxis are bookable via Northern Railway's service, ensuring a smooth journey to your onward destination.

If you fancy cycling, bike hire options are available, though not directly at the station, which supports an eco-friendly travel lifestyle amidst the urban setting.
